City Kitchen celebrates one year with a free-food birthday carnival

To celebrate its first birthday, Hell's Kitchen food court City Kitchen and the Row NYC hotel are throwing an open-to-the-public carnival bash featuring a spread of free snacks from the hall's vendors. On Thursday, March 31st from 5 to 9pm, guests will be able to enjoy miniature versions of signature items, such as shrimp rolls from Luke's Lobster, sliders from Whitman's, sushi from Azuki and tacos (shrimp, carne asada) from Gabriela's. For a sweeter bite, Dough will be handing out doughnut holes.

Beyond bites, the 4,000 square-foot market will play host to a variety of live entertainment, from a magician to jugglers and a yet-to-be-announced DJ. Patrons can also enter into a City Kitchen raffle to win branded swag like water bottles and coolers, as well as a one-night stay at the Row NYC hotel.
